Comparative Analysis: USB 2.0 vs. USB 3.0 Micro Cables

When evaluating Micro USB cables, the difference between USB 2.0 and USB 3.0 is crucial. USB 2.0 supports data transfer speeds of up to 480 Mbps, while USB 3.0 can achieve rates up to 5 Gbps. This is a substantial increase, making USB 3.0 superior for device synchronization and large file transfers. A study by the USB Implementers Forum revealed that users experience a 10x faster data transfer with USB 3.0 compared to USB 2.0. This efficiency can significantly impact productivity, especially for data-heavy tasks.

Another factor to consider is power output. USB 2.0 typically provides 2.5 watts, while USB 3.0 can supply up to 4.5 watts. This higher output allows devices to charge faster, reducing downtime. However, not all devices leverage these capabilities. Some older devices do not support fast charging, creating a gap between potential and actual performance.

Real-life testing shows that users often overlook cable quality. A poorly made USB 3.0 cable may not deliver its full potential. Inconsistent performance can lead to frustration. This variability reminds users to weigh both specifications and the quality of cable construction in their choices.

Tips for Maintaining and Extending the Life of Your Micro USB Cable

To ensure your micro USB cables last longer, regular care is essential. First, avoid bending cables sharply. This can damage internal wires. Instead, store them loosely to prevent wear. Using a cable organizer can help keep them tidy. Dust and debris may also cause issues. Clean the connectors periodically with a soft cloth. This simple step can enhance both charging efficiency and data transfer speed.

Understanding the environment where the cables are used is crucial. Excessive heat or cold can affect their performance. Avoid leaving cables in hot cars or near radiators. It’s important to monitor how you use them too. If the cable starts to fray, it might be time for a replacement. Ignoring early signs of damage can lead to more serious issues later. Always assess the condition of your cables before use. Taking these small steps can significantly extend their lifespan.

Maximizing Connectivity: The Advantages of High-Speed Optical Fiber USB 3.1 Extension Cables for Modern Devices

In today's fast-paced digital landscape, connectivity is paramount, and high-speed optical fiber USB 3.1 extension cables are redefining the way devices communicate. The advent of optical fiber technology facilitates data transmission rates of up to 10Gbps, allowing users to transfer large files seamlessly and efficiently. With a remarkable transmission capability over distances of up to 100 meters, these cables eliminate the common drawbacks associated with traditional copper cables, such as signal loss and degradation.

One of the standout features of high-speed optical fiber cables is their lightweight and slim design, making them ideal for in-wall installations in modern buildings. This flexibility not only enhances aesthetics by reducing clutter but also contributes to a more organized and sophisticated setup.
